Joey Lawrence Files for Divorce from Chandie Yawn-Nelson After 15 Years of Marriage

The Quarantine season has sadly seen another couple parting ways. Joey Lawrence and his wife, Chandie Yawn-Nelson are going their separate ways after 15 years of marriage. The Melissa and Joey actor filed for divorce from Yawn-Nelson on Tuesday.

Joey and Chandie met as teenagers, when a then 16-year-old Lawrence was on vacation at Disney World in 1993. The actor however went on to marry Michelle Vella in 2002, but they split in 2005. Joey and Chandie reconnected more than a decade later and wed in 2005.

Getting Married at Disney World

In an Interview back in 2006, the actor revealed that during their 90s meet-cute at Disney World, Joey joked about getting married at the theme park. “Being the cheesy romantic that I was, I said, ‘Hey look, there’s the Disney wedding chapel! Maybe we’ll get married there one day.’ “Long story short, we did!” Turns out dreams do come true, and the couple’s fantasy came to life when they got hitched in 2005 at the Magic Kingdom.

In 2017, Lawrence and Yawn-Nelson filed for bankruptcy with just $8,000 in the bank and $60 in cash after accumulating $355,517.27 worth of liabilities. That included $132,000 in credit card bills, $100,000 owed for automobiles, $88,000 in back taxes, $54,000 in unpaid rent and $32,000 for an unpaid loan. The bankruptcy case was later settled in 2018.

The reason for the couple’s separation has not been revealed yet, and there has also been no information regarding child custody.
